Who we are
The Bancroft Carlow Pastoral Charge is a 4 point charge of the United Church of Canada. Two of our churches, St. Paul’s United Church and Carlow United Church are open year round with regular worship services held Sunday mornings. Our other two churches, St. Andrew’s located in L’Amable and St. Matthew’s in Baptiste Village are open during the summer months. St. Andrew’s is used for alternative types of events such as a Strawberry social, music evenings and cross cultural programs. From Father’s Day to Labour Day, 2019, St. Matthew’s will be holding services Sunday evenings with food, music, stories and fun based on the Chautauqua shows.
Our churches are a place to worship and experience the joy of a welcoming community. We often have times to eat together. St. Paul’s has a choir led by our music director who plays our beautiful baby grand piano and the organ. St. Paul’s, Carlow and St. Matthew’s are accessible and are well integrated into the needs of the community. St. Paul’s, Carlow and St. Andrew’s have active The United Church Women groups and are always open to new members. St.Paul’s UCW have a Prayer Shawl program whereby they knit and crochet prayer shawls for people who are in need of comfort.
Outreach is an important part of who we are. In 2018 we sponsored a Syrian refugee family. We provide grocery cards to those in need of food and financial support to community agencies such as North Hastings Community Trust, St. John’s Helpers (weekly community lunch), Bancroft Community Transit and youth and children’s programs We have provided wood, gas cards and beds to those in need. Part of our Outreach is to organize events for the community such as Theology on Tap (a theological discussion group that takes place at the local tavern), sponsoring films in conjunction with our Indigenous community and lunches. We support PFLAG and are allies for LGBTQ2 Spirit.

Leader Bio:
Rev. Lynn was born Lynn Young at the old Red Cross Hospital the fourth of five children to Art and Gwen Young.
Her family home was right across from the present day Beer Store in Bancroft, Ontario.
Her love of church and understanding of the Christian faith came from her Mom; her love of people came from her Dad.
It seemed only fitting that at the age of 12 she felt called into ministry. Like a switchback trail leading up a steep mountain Rev. Lynn’s journey to ministry would take some time and some twists and turns.
Along the way she picked up her most devoted travelling companions: her husband, Glenn, over 37 years and 3 daughters, Jacqui, Janet, and Carrie.
St. Paul’s United Church in Bancroft would be instrumental in the shaping of Lynn’s ministry as were the other churches in the North Hastings area.
She became a candidate for ministry in The United Church of Canada in the Spring of 1999. She attended Queens Theological College and graduated in 2002 having completed studies for a Masters of Divinity and an eight month internship in Windsor Nova Scotia.
She was ordained in May of the same year.
Since her ordination she has served 4 Pastoral Charges from the Ottawa Valley to Calgary and back to Prince Edward County.
In July of 2012 she returned to her hometown to become the minister to the Bancroft-Carlow Pastoral Charge.
“It has been the greatest honour and privilege to share in the ministry of these churches.”
As year six begins Rev. Lynn is excited about the work to which God is calling. Inclusion, forgiveness, and diversity are the hallmarks of a great church…and “I have four of the best!” says Rev. Lynn.
Join us in our worship and our work…for you can’t have one without the other.
